Home
last modified time | relevance | path

Searched refs:singleSize (Results 1 - 2 of 2) sorted by relevance

/base/update/updater/services/common/ring_buffer/
H A Dring_buffer.cpp30 bool RingBuffer::Init(uint32_t singleSize, uint32_t num) in Init() argument
32 if (singleSize == 0 || num == 0 || (num & (num - 1)) != 0) { // power of 2 in Init()
33 LOG(ERROR) << "singleSize:" << singleSize << " num:" << num << " error"; in Init()
43 bufArray_[i] = new (std::nothrow) uint8_t [singleSize] {}; in Init()
45 LOG(ERROR) << "new buf " << i << " size " << singleSize << " error"; in Init() local
53 singleSize_ = singleSize; in Init()
84 LOG(ERROR) << "RingBuffer push error, len:" << len << " singleSize:" << singleSize_; in Push()
H A Dring_buffer.h33 [[nodiscard]] bool Init(uint32_t singleSize, uint32_t num);

Completed in 2 milliseconds